Fiber Optic Technician (OSP - Aerial & Underground) - Job DescriptionPosition SummaryThe Fiber Optic Technician is responsible for the installation, maintenance, and repair of outside plant (OSP) fiber optic cable systems, including both aerial and underground infrastructure. This role supports reliable network performance through high-quality workmanship, technical expertise, and strict adherence to safety standards. The position requires working outdoors in varying conditions and collaborating with field crews and supervisors.
Key Responsibilities- Install fiber optic cable systems in both aerial (pole lines) and underground (trenched or bored) environments.
- Perform cable placement activities, including pulling, stringing, and securing fiber optic cables to required specifications.
- Inspect existing infrastructure for wear, damage, or performance issues and perform necessary repairs or replacements.
- Conduct maintenance activities such as re-tensioning aerial cables and repairing underground lines to prevent service interruptions.
- Perform fiber splicing and termination, connecting cable segments and integrating them into active networks.
- Use testing equipment to verify signal integrity, troubleshoot issues, and ensure compliance with industry standards.
- Operate equipment such as bucket trucks, trenchers, or directional bore support tools as needed.
- Maintain a strong focus on job site safety, adhering to all company and regulatory safety requirements.
- Collaborate with crew members and follow direction from lead or senior technicians.
- Maintain tools, vehicles, and equipment in safe and working condition.
- Complete daily reports, documentation, and test results accurately and on time.
- Perform additional duties as assigned.
